Output 73efecace32ebf1b011fd60351fc17889d7d3ed38028c59751e5cd4a652c26ae:39

value
315301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94dee63d1f836aa972c2b1e6673c2b3e007d2375 OP_EQUAL
address
3FGAxFi5JQbiQajqtpCRD9e7jwDAAeMupr
transaction
73efecace32ebf1b011fd60351fc17889d7d3ed38028c59751e5cd4a652c26ae
confirmations
182942
spent
true